SAH induces MMP-9 activation and activates astrocytes, oligodendrocyte precursors and microglia in white matter. (A) Representative gelatin zymography demonstrates that activity of MMP-9, but not MMP-2, increases in SAH compared to sham mice at 24 h after SAH induction. (B) Quantification of MMP-9 activity on gelatin zymography. **P < 0.01; Values are mean ± SD; n=3 for each. (C) Representative 3,3 diaminobenzidine (DAB) staining of glial fibrillary acid protein (GFAP), PDGFRα, and Iba-1 in the corpus callosum in sham and SAH mice at 24 hours (Scale bar = 100μm).
